Cruz Beckham, the youngest son of Victoria Beckham, has once again captured the internet's attention with a delightful viral video featuring four members of the iconic Spice Girls. The charming clip, which showcases a laid-back musical moment at home, has ignited fresh speculation about a potential reunion tour in 2026.
A Musical Gathering of Legends
In the heartwarming video, Cruz Beckham demonstrates his knack for creating viral content by bringing together his mother Victoria Beckham alongside fellow Spice Girls Emma Bunton, Geri Halliwell, and Mel C. The group harmonises beautifully around a table while Cruz accompanies them on guitar, recreating the band's classic hit 'Viva Forever' in a relaxed, intimate setting.
The footage, which was shared on Instagram, quickly amassed tens of thousands of likes and enthusiastic comments from fans worldwide. Cruz captioned the post with a tantalising hint about future developments, writing: "I think i found my openers… you think they have potential? something exciting coming later today ;) keep an eye out and get involved."

Reunion Rumours Intensify
The timing of this viral moment coincides with growing speculation about a potential Spice Girls reunion in 2026, which would mark the 30th anniversary of their groundbreaking single 'Wannabe'. Mel C recently addressed these rumours during an interview, acknowledging the significance of the upcoming milestone.
"Well, this is the thing," Mel C explained. "If you remember looking back to 2019 when we did our stadium tour, Victoria wasn't with us... so she has to have that experience." Her comments suggest that the band members are considering how to make future reunions more inclusive of all original members.
Recent Celebrations and Connections
The Spice Girls have maintained their connections in recent months, reuniting earlier this year to celebrate Emma Bunton's 50th birthday. Mel C reflected on this gathering, noting: "We missed Melanie B – she wasn't there, sadly – but the four of us, the rest of us, were there, and it was so lovely. And you know what it's like. It was a big birthday. So you feel very nostalgic."
She added meaningfully: "So we're probably closer now than we have been in a very long time. And I'm always keeping my fingers crossed." These sentiments, combined with Cruz Beckham's viral video, have created perfect conditions for reunion speculation to flourish.
